BEEF CHIMICHANGAS
The family requests this all the time. It is easy for my husband to make when I have to work late. Top with shredded cheese, lettuce, tomato, salsa, and sour cream.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C).
- Brown the ground beef, onion, garlic, taco seasoning, and oregano in a skillet over medium heat, breaking the meat up into crumbles as it cooks, about 8 minutes. Drain off excess fat. Stir in sour cream, chilies, and vinegar until well mixed. Remove from heat, and mix in the Cheddar cheese.
- Melt margarine in a small skillet over low heat. When melted, dip each tortilla into the margarine for about 30 seconds, or until soft. Place the softened tortilla onto a baking sheet, and fill with about 1/3 cup of the meat mixture. Fold the right and left sides of the tortilla over the filling, then the top and bottom, making an envelope that completely encloses the filling. Flip the tortilla seam side down on the baking sheet. Repeat with remaining tortillas and filling.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the tortilla is crisp, about 15 minutes.

BEEF CHIMICHANGAS
My husband loves this beef chimichanga recipe! I often double the recipe and freeze the chimichangas individually to take out as needed. I serve them with shredded lettuce and sour cream. -Schelby Thompson, Camden Wyoming, Delaware

Steps:
- In a large skillet, cook beef over medium heat until no longer pink; drain. Stir in the beans, onion, 1/2 cup tomato sauce, chili powder, garlic and cumin. , Spoon about 1/3 cup of beef mixture off-center on each tortilla. Fold edge nearest filling up and over to cover. Fold in both sides and roll up. Fasten with toothpicks. In a large saucepan, combine the chilies, peppers and remaining tomato sauce; heat through., In an electric skillet or deep-fat fryer, heat 1 in. of oil to 375°. Fry the chimichangas for 1-1/2 to 2 minutes on each side or until browned. Drain on paper towels. Sprinkle with cheese. Serve with sauce.

EASY BEEF CHIMICHANGA RECIPE
Cheesy Beef and Bean Chimichanga Recipe with spinach and lots of cheese. These oven baked chimichangas are incredibly delicious and super easy to make.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400F and line ba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Using a skillet, add 1 lb ground beef and 1 small chopped onion. Saute over medium high heat, stirring few times and breaking the meat into small pieces with a wooden spoon. Saute until ground beef is browned, about 7-10 minutes. Drain grease.
- Next, add 2 cloves of finely chopped garlic, 2 teaspoons of taco seasoning, salt and pepper to taste. Give it a good stir with a spoon. Stir in 4 oz. of green chilies and 16 oz. refried beans until well blended. Turn off heat, cover with a lid.
- Place warm tortilla on a plate and add about a 1/2 cup of the ground beef mixture onto the center. Add Cheddar Jack cheese and chopped spinach.
- Now, fold left and right side of the tortilla over the filling, then fold in top and bottom sides of the tortilla over the filling forming a chimichanga.
- Brush top of chimichanga with melted butter and bake for 15-20 minutes or until top of chimichangas turn golden brown color.
- Serve Beef Chimichangas with salsa, cubed tomatoes, cheese, chopped spinach, sour cream and finely chopped chives. Enjoy!

BEEF AND BEAN CHIMICHANGAS
This is an awesome recipe, if you like Mexican food! These tasty beef and bean treats are baked instead of fried.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Brown the ground beef in a skillet over medium-high heat. Drain excess grease, and add the onion, bell pepper, and corn. Cook for about 5 more minutes, or until vegetables are tender. Stir in the taco sauce, and season with chili powder, garlic salt and cumin, stirring until blended. Cook until heated through, then remove from heat, and set aside.
- Open the can of beans, and spread a thin layer of beans onto each of the tortillas. Spoon the beef mixture down the center, and then top with as much shredded cheese as you like. Roll up the tortillas, and place them seam-side down onto a baking sheet. Brush the tortillas with melted butter.
- Bake for 30 to 35 minutes in the preheated oven, or until golden brown. Serve with lettuce and tomato.
